none
Script Fazendo ligação ODBC RRS feed

  • Pergunta

  •  

    Boa Tarde!

    Gostaria de saber se tem como e se tiver, como fazer um script para fazer uma conexão odbc, setando banco senha tudo.

     

    Obrigado..

    quinta-feira, 20 de setembro de 2007 16:47

Respostas

  • Crie o arquivo o arquivo .REG e faça um .BAT com o seguinte comando:

    REG IMPORT "\\SEUSERVER\SEUSHARE\SEUREG.REG"

    Coloque em uma diretiva de script de inicialização (start up), link a GPO onde as contas de computadores recebem esta GPO. Quando eles forem reiniciados eles executarão o script.

    O seu reg deve ser assim

    Windows Registry Editor Version 5.00
    
    [HKEY_LOCAL_MACHINE\SOFTWARE\ODBC\ODBC.INI\TECH]
    "Driver"="C:\\Windows\\system32\\SQLSRV32.dll"
    "Server"="seu servidor SQL"
    "Database"="banco de dados"
    "LastUser"="seu usuario sql"
    "UserName"="seu usuario sql" 
    "Password"="sua senha" 
    
    
    [HKEY_LOCAL_MACHINE\SOFTWARE\ODBC\ODBC.INI\ODBC Data Sources]
    "nome da sua conexão ODBC"="SQL Server"

    Atente para a última linha onde sua configuração se dá na chave e não no valor.

    Fábio de Paula Junior

    segunda-feira, 27 de fevereiro de 2012 12:04
    Moderador

Todas as Respostas

  •  

    Caro colega, segue um exemplo para utilização com o Sql server.

     

    Windows Registry Editor Version 5.00

    [HKEY_LOCAL_MACHINE\SOFTWARE\ODBC\ODBC.INI\nome_banco]
    "Driver"="C:\\WINDOWS\\system32\\SQLSRV32.dll"
    "Description"="descrição"
    "Server"="servidor"
    "Database"="banco"
    "LastUser"="usuário"


    [HKEY_LOCAL_MACHINE\SOFTWARE\ODBC\ODBC.INI\ODBC Data Sources]
    "nome_banco"="SQL Server"

     

    terça-feira, 2 de outubro de 2007 18:11
  • Crie uma ODBC utizando o 

    C:\Windows\System32\odbcad32.exe

    e depois veja no registro qual o nome da chave onde ele grava a senha.

    Fábio de Paula Junior

    sábado, 25 de fevereiro de 2012 13:24
    Moderador
  • Bom dia, Galera!!!

    A dúvida de Marcelo Baumann é a mesma que tenho. Mas precisaria de um script para utilizar na GPO para configurar em todas as máquinas. Mais provável em .vbs

    Já procurei aqui no fórum algum script que configure todas as opções mas nenhum deles configura a senha para a Conexão sendo ela autenticada por SQL.

    Poderiam me ajudar?


    Aureliano Silva IT Support Analist

    segunda-feira, 27 de fevereiro de 2012 11:35
  • Crie o arquivo o arquivo .REG e faça um .BAT com o seguinte comando:

    REG IMPORT "\\SEUSERVER\SEUSHARE\SEUREG.REG"

    Coloque em uma diretiva de script de inicialização (start up), link a GPO onde as contas de computadores recebem esta GPO. Quando eles forem reiniciados eles executarão o script.

    O seu reg deve ser assim

    Windows Registry Editor Version 5.00
    
    [HKEY_LOCAL_MACHINE\SOFTWARE\ODBC\ODBC.INI\TECH]
    "Driver"="C:\\Windows\\system32\\SQLSRV32.dll"
    "Server"="seu servidor SQL"
    "Database"="banco de dados"
    "LastUser"="seu usuario sql"
    "UserName"="seu usuario sql" 
    "Password"="sua senha" 
    
    
    [HKEY_LOCAL_MACHINE\SOFTWARE\ODBC\ODBC.INI\ODBC Data Sources]
    "nome da sua conexão ODBC"="SQL Server"

    Atente para a última linha onde sua configuração se dá na chave e não no valor.

    Fábio de Paula Junior

    segunda-feira, 27 de fevereiro de 2012 12:04
    Moderador
  • Valeu Fábio, funcionou bem!!!

    Agora queria saber como posso colocar esta reg dentro de um VBscript., que será colocado no Logon Script dos usuários.

    Valeu!!


    Aureliano Silva IT Support Analist

    segunda-feira, 27 de fevereiro de 2012 14:54
  • segunda-feira, 27 de fevereiro de 2012 17:13
    Moderador